Vince Zampella, a Gaming Pioneer, Has Passed Away in an LA Traffic Collision
Vince Zampella, who helped create the wildly popular franchise Call of Duty, has tragically died in a car accident in the state of California at the age of 55.
The tragic news was confirmed by Electronic Arts, the parent company of Respawn Entertainment, the video game company which he helped establish.
The celebrated video game developer passed away following his vehicle was involved in a crash and was engulfed in flames on a motorway in LA on Sunday morning, according to.
"This represents a devastating loss, and our deepest sympathies go to Vince's family, those closest to him, and everyone impacted by his work," an official with Electronic Arts said.
